Sigiriya Rock Fortress
Culture

Sigiriya Rock Fortress

Cultural Triangle

An ancient rock fortress rising 200m above the jungle, with 5th-century frescoes and spectacular views. One of Sri Lanka's most iconic UNESCO World Heritage sites.

Galle Fort
Culture

Galle Fort

Southern Coast

A living, breathing colonial fort city built by the Portuguese and developed by the Dutch in the 16th century. Cobbled streets, boutique hotels and ocean views await.

Yala National Park
Safari

Yala National Park

Safari Zone

Sri Lanka's most visited national park boasts the highest leopard density on earth. Spot elephants, sloth bears, crocodiles and hundreds of bird species.

Dambulla Cave Temple
Culture

Dambulla Cave Temple

Cultural Triangle

A UNESCO-listed complex of five caves adorned with over 150 Buddha statues and 2,100 sq metres of vivid murals spanning 2,000 years of Sri Lankan art.

Sacred City of Anuradhapura
Culture

Sacred City of Anuradhapura

Cultural Triangle

Sri Lanka's ancient capital for over 1,000 years. Home to the sacred Bodhi tree - the oldest recorded tree in the world - and towering white dagobas.

Mirissa Beach
Beach

Mirissa Beach

Southern Coast

A crescent bay of golden sand fringed with coconut palms. The best place in Sri Lanka for blue whale watching from November to April.

Udawalawe National Park
Safari

Udawalawe National Park

Safari Zone

The best park in Sri Lanka for reliable elephant sightings. Herds of 50+ elephants gather daily at the reservoir, with water buffaloes and eagles in abundance.
